Seeking a fresh start after personal tragedy and a painful divorce, nurse practitioner and midwife Melinda "Mel" Monroe leaves Los Angeles for the remote, rugged
Northern California town of Virgin River. Having answered an ad to work with local physician Dr. Vernon Mullins, Mel expects a rustic haven to heal her wounds. Instead, she encounters a dilapidated cabin, a hostile doctor who never asked for her help, and a community steeped in secrets.Despite the rocky beginning, Mel’s warmth and medical expertise slowly win over the townspeople, most notably Jack Sheridan, a charming former Marine and local bar owner. A deep, undeniable chemistry sparks between Mel and Jack, though both carry heavy emotional baggage. Jack is dealing with PTSD from his
military service and an increasingly toxic, on-again-off-again entanglement with local bartender Charmaine, who soon drops a bombshell: she is pregnant with Jack’s twins.As Mel and Jack navigate their budding romance, Virgin River proves to be far from a sleepy backwater. The town is a hotbed of hidden dangers and high-stakes drama. Mel finds herself treating wounded criminals in secret, while Jack becomes unwittingly embroiled in a violent local drug ring run by ruthless kingpin Calvin, operating out of nearby illegal marijuana farms. Meanwhile, Dr. Mullins struggles to accept Mel while hiding his failing eyesight and managing his complex, decades-long romance with Hope McCrea, the town’s fiercely meddling mayor.Mel’s own past refuses to stay buried when her estranged sister-in-law arrives, threatening to drag up painful memories of the car accident that killed Mel’s husband, Mark. Heartbreak deepens when Mel, torn apart by Jack’s impending fatherhood and her inability to move past her grief, briefly leaves town. Jack’s life hangs in the balance in the subsequent season when he is brutally shot inside his bar, launching a tense whodunit investigation that casts suspicion on nearly everyone, from jealous rivals to dangerous drug dealers.Over subsequent months, the town rallies through a gauntlet of crises, including devastating wildfires, bitter custody battles over Charmaine’s twins, and shocking revelations about Jack’s true paternity. Mel faces her own medical miracles and devastating losses, including a high-risk pregnancy that forces her and Jack to question their future. Through it all, Virgin River remains a place where profound tragedy and enduring community strength collide, constantly testing the resilience of its residents as they fight for redemption, healing, and lasting love against the backdrop of the majestic redwoods.
